TURN-208: Gatevale turnstile counters at the Merrow Field pilot double-count when a rotation reverses mid-cycle. Attendance totals drift roughly 2% high per event. The debounce window fix is implemented, reviewed by Ilsa, and soak-tested across two simulated match days without drift. Ready for your cut; the candidate build is identified below.

trace token, tagag-tafog: htk6_5ed18c

Q: Why did only some pages rebuild after my merge?
A: Glimmerforge tracks content hashes per route. Only routes whose inputs changed get rebuilt; shared layouts trigger wider rebuilds. If you see stale pages, check the dependency graph output in the build log first — it's usually a missed template reference, not a bug. Full rebuilds are expensive; don't force one without asking in the build channel. To run a forced rebuild against the sealed production bucket, supply the recovery passphrase below.

vault phrase of taweg-kafof = oliax-zorael

Ticket: CSV import wizard drops trailing empty columns — Ledgerquill Suite.

When a file from the Marrowfield export ends rows with empty cells, the wizard silently truncates them, shifting mappings on re-import. Fix is in the parser branch; reviewer should verify header alignment against the fixture set. Repro build is identified by the token below.

pipeline stamp: htk31_f769b577b3028a4e9958e5bb8d1259a